Authentic Heritage & Story
Almond House Sugar Pootharekulu is an ultra-thin delicate South Indian sweet made from rice starch and layered with a mixture of clarified butter (ghee), sugar, and cardamom. These sheets have a paper-like texture made from a fine rice batter that is cooked gently on hot pans until they become translucent and crispy. The sweetened filling inside offers a gentle sweetness, which is contributed by ghee's rich buttery flavor thus making the treat light yet indulgent.
The process begins from soaking a particular type of rice, grinding it to the batter's fine level, and then cooking it as wafer-thin sheets on the pan covered with a cloth that is heated. When the sheets are finished, they are generously sprinkled with sugar, cardamom, and ghee, and then rolled up into nice cylindrical shapes. This eventually leads to the making of a sweet crispiness that is chewy, flaky, and heavenly at the same time. The Sugar Pootharekulu of Almond House not only keeps the authenticity but also the artistry of this ancient delicacy, being a representation of the rich culture of Andhra Pradesh.
